An inspirational tale of triumph over extraordinary setbacks, A Colonel & A Cowboy tells the remarkable story of rodeo great Stran Smith and retired U.S. Army Colonel J. Craig Flowers. Stran Smith's journey to becoming a World Champion rodeo cowboy is woven together with Colonel Flowers' experiences supporting some of the most elite teams in the world. Through dramatic, real-life storytelling and humor, these two native Texans offer a profound analysis of what it takes to move from great to elite: Mission, Mindset, and Process. The book blends actionable lessons from Smith's historic journey to winning a gold buckle with Flowers' expertise as a nationally-recognized leadership coach and speaker. Readers will gain a roadmap for success and an inspiring glimpse into the mindset of the elite.

Stran T Smith is a World Champion Cowboy who spent 20 years rodeoing professionally. He is a 5th generation Texas rancher, Texas Cowboy Hall of Fame inductee, and co-founder of STS Ranchwear. Stran has become an inspirational figure in the sport of rodeo and beyond, sharing his faith and his remarkable story of overcoming unbelievable setbacks and personal loss, all on his journey to achieve his dream of winning on the world stage and in life.
J. Craig Flowers is a 4th generation native Texan who served over 25 years in the US Army. A Texas Christian University alum and baseball player, his final military assignment was at West Point. Founder of the Sideline Leadership Company, he works with CEOs, NCAA Coaches, educators, and other industry leaders, sharing how the most elite teams on earth behave to win. As a keynote speaker, Craig uses humor and storytelling to connect to audiences. Craig is often referred to as the "Paul Harvey of the Texas Hill Country."
